S. 16 (110th)

A bill to provide for certain land to be held in trust for the Burns Paiute Tribe.

Summary

Directs the Secretary of the Interior to take into trust for the benefit of the Burns Paiute Tribe of the Burns Paiute Indian Colony of Oregon specified real property located in Malheur County, Oregon, if, at the time of conveyance or transfer to the Secretary, no adverse legal claim (including an outstanding lien, mortgage, or tax) exists with respect to the property. Requires such land to be considered to be: (1) part of the Burns Paiute Reservation; (2) Indian lands as defined in the Indian Gaming Regulatory Act; and (3) eligible for class I, class II, and class III gaming in accordance with that Act
